Inspirational Horse Quotes
Horses are one of the most popular animals on the planet, and they have inspired plenty of great quotes over the years. There’s nothing quite like coming across the perfect quote that sums up your feelings or helps you get through a difficult situation with the power of positivity.
Horses are incredibly beautiful and powerful animals, which makes them perfect subjects to inspire you to do great things in your life! I have selected the best list of inspirational horse quotes that will help motivate you to reach your goals, overcome obstacles, and live the life you’ve always wanted.
Many people feel connected to horses, especially when they’re in the presence of the majestic animal. However, sometimes it can be difficult to convey your feelings through a simple conversation or the written word. If you want to express just how moved you are by horses, here are quotes about horses to inspire you.
- The horse, with beauty unsurpassed, strength immeasurable and grace unlike any other, still remains humble enough to carry a man upon his back.
- No hour of life is wasted that is spent in the saddle. (Winston Churchill )
- The essential joy of being with horses is that it brings us in contact with the rare elements of grace, beauty, spirit, and freedom. ( Sharon Ralls Lemon )
- I figure if a girl wants to be a legend, she should go ahead and be one. (Calamity Jane)
- Courage is being scared to death… and saddling up anyway. (John Wayne)
- A horse loves freedom, and the weariest old work horse will roll on the ground or break into a lumbering gallop when he is turned loose into the open. ( Gerald Raftery)
- There are only two emotions that belong in the saddle; one is a sense of humor and the other is patience. (John Lyons)
- You can see what man-made from the seat of an automobile, but the best way to see what God made is from the back of a horse ( Charles M. Russell)
- No one can teach riding so well as a horse ( C. S. Lewis )
- Courage is being scared to death but saddling up anyway (John Wayne)
- There is no better place to heal a broken heart than on the back of a horse ( Missy Lyons)
- Horses change lives. They give our young people confidence and self-esteem. They provide peace and tranquility to troubled souls, they give us hope. (Toni Robinson)
- Success is the sum of small efforts, repeated day-in and day-out. (Robert Collier)
- For a human to win, it is not necessary for a horse to lose. You should not have to take things away from a horse or break him in fragments in order to train him; rather you should add to the horse. The goal should be making, not breaking.(Cherry Hill)
- An old adage says that a good rider can hear his horse speak and a great rider can hear his horse whisper. (Elizabeth Letts)
- A horse is worth more than riches. (Spanish Proverb)
- I can make a General in five minutes, but a good horse is hard to replace (Abraham Lincoln)
- When you are on a great horse, you have the best seat you will ever have.
- There is something about riding down the street on a prancing horse that makes you feel like something, even when you ain’t a thing (Will Rogers)
- There is no other feeling in the world to compare with it if one loves a great horse. It gives a thrill that nothing else ever can. It cannot be put into words, because words cannot express it.
- Riding a horse is not a gentle hobby, to be picked up and laid down like a game of Solitaire. It is a grand passion (Ralph Waldo Emerson)
- When riding a horse, we borrow freedom ( Helen Thomson)
- It excites me that no matter how much machinery replaces the horse, the work it can do is still measured in horsepower… even in this space age. And although a riding horse often weighs half a ton, and a big drafter a full ton, either can be led about by a piece of string if he has been wisely trained. This to me is a constant source of wonder, and challenge. (Marguret Henry)
- You cannot train a horse with shouts and expect it to obey a whisper. (Dagobert D. Runes)
- If you’re lucky enough to draw a good horse, you still have to ride him, then the next ones. (Chris LeDoux.)
- If the horse does not enjoy his work, his rider will have no joy. (H.H. Isenbart)
- A true horseman does not look at a horse with his eyes, he looks at his horse with his heart.
- Equestrian art is the perfect understanding and harmony between horse and rider (Nuno Oliveira)
- A good trainer can hear a horse speak to him. A great trainer can hear him whisper. (Monty Roberts)
- A true horseman does not look at a horse with his eyes, he looks at his horse with his heart.
- They say princes learn no art truly, but the art of horsemanship. The reason is, the brave beast is no flatterer. He will throw a prince as soon as his groom. (Ben Johnson)
- There are only two emotions that belong in the saddle; one is a sense of humor and the other is patience. (John Lyons)
- When I bestride him, I soar, I am a hawk: he trots the air; the earth sings when he touches it; the basest horn of his hoof is more musical than the pipe of Hermes. (William Shakespeare.)
- Success is letting go of fear. (Carl Wittaker)
- Riding a horse is not a gentle hobby, to be picked up and laid down like a game of Solitaire. It is a grand passion. (Ralph Waldo Emerson)
- A man on a horse is spiritually as well as physically bigger than a man on foot. (John Steinbeck)
- It’s a lot like nuts and bolts, if the rider’s nuts, the horse bolts! (Nicholas Evans)
- The wind of heaven is that which blows between a horse’s ears. (Arabian Proverb)
- There are many wonderful places in the world, but one of my favorite places is on the back of my horse. (Rolf Kopfle)
- A man on a horse is spiritually, as well as physically, bigger than a man on foot. (John Steinbeck)
- I am still under the impression that there is nothing alive quite so beautiful as a horse. (John Galsworthy)
- The essential joy of being with horses is that it brings us in contact with the rare elements of grace, beauty, spirit, and freedom. (Sharon Ralls) Lemon

- It is the difficult horses that have the most to give you. (Lendon Gray)
- Of all creatures God made at the Creation, there is none more excellent, or so much to be respected as a horse (Bedouin Legend)
- You cannot train a horse with shouts and expect it to obey a whisper. (Dagobert D. Runes)
- Every time you ride, your either teaching or un-teaching your horse. (Gordon Wright)
- If anybody expects to calm a horse down by tiring him out with riding swiftly and far, his supposition is the reverse of the truth. (Xenophon)
- Love means attention, which means looking after the things we love. We call this stable management. (George H. Morris)
- One reason why birds and horses are happy is because they are not trying to impress other birds and horses. (Dale Carnegie)
- Words are as beautiful as wild horses, and sometimes as difficult to corral. (Ted Berkman)
- There are only two emotions that belong in the saddle; one is a sense of humor and the other is patience. (John Lyons)
- By reason of his elegance, he resembles an image painted in a palace,though he is as majestic as the palace itself. (Emir Abd-el-Kader)
- There on the tips of fair fresh flowers feedeth he; How joyous is his neigh, there in the midst of sacred pollen hidden all hidden he; how joyous is his neigh. (Navajo Song)
- A horse doesn’t care how much you know until he knows how much you care. (Pat Parelli)
- Horse sense is the thing a horse has which keeps it from betting on people. (W.C. Fields)
- The best feeling is when you can connect and build a strong bond with your horse.
- The history of mankind is carried on the back of a horse.
- I should like to be a horse. (Queen Elizabeth II)
- There is no better place to heal a broken heart than on the back of a horse. (Missy Lyons)
- A horse is the projection of peoples’ dreams about themselves – strong, powerful, beautiful – and it has the capability of giving us escape from our mundane existence. (Pam Brown)
- When I bestride him, I soar, I am a hawk: he trots the air; the earth sings when he touches it; the basest horn of his hoof is more musical than the pipe of Hermes. (William Shakespeare)
- Flaming enthusiasm, backed up by horse sense and persistence, is the quality that most frequently makes for success. (Dale Carnegie)
- All you need for happiness is a good gun, a good horse, and a good wife. (Daniel Boone)
- There are only two emotions that belong in the saddle; one is a sense of humor, and the other is patience. (John Lyons)
- A polo handicap is a person’s ticket to the world. (Sir Winston Churchill)
